Sustainable Hardwood Sourcing: What You Need to Know


Among one of the most essential aspects of sustainable hardwood flooring is responsible sourcing. Ethical distributors abide by guidelines established by companies such as the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C) and the Sustainable Forestry Initiative (SFI). These accreditations ensure that the wood utilized in flooring items is gathered responsibly, maintaining eco-friendly equilibrium and avoiding over-logging.


Reclaimed timber has actually likewise become a top selection for sustainability-minded home owners. Restored from old barns, storehouses, and historical structures, recovered hardwood flooring brings personality and originality to any type of space while removing the need for brand-new tree harvesting.


An additional innovative choice getting popularity is engineered hardwood. Unlike strong wood floor covering, which includes a single item of lumber, crafted timber attributes multiple layers, decreasing the total demand for slow-growing hardwood types. By using a smaller quantity of solid timber and integrating it with sustainable materials, this choice gives the very same elegance with a reduced ecological impact.


The Benefits of Eco-Friendly Hardwood Flooring


The benefits of choosing sustainable hardwood flooring exceed its environmental impact. Homeowners are increasingly identifying the useful benefits of these flooring choices, consisting of resilience, improved indoor air high quality, and long-lasting price savings.


Several standard flooring materials have volatile natural substances (VOCs), which can launch dangerous gases right into the air in time. Eco-friendly hardwood floors make use of natural, non-toxic surfaces that promote healthier indoor air, making them suitable for households and individuals with allergies or respiratory level of sensitivities.


Resilience is an additional vital aspect to think about. With proper maintenance and treatment, top notch hardwood floors can last for years, decreasing the demand for frequent replacements and decreasing waste. Water-Based Finishes for a Safer Home


Typical coatings typically have harsh chemicals that contribute to indoor air pollution. In feedback, several producers have actually transitioned to water-based finishes that are low in VOCs, making sure a much healthier home without compromising on the protective high qualities of the surface.


Bamboo and Cork: The Rising Stars


Although practically not hardwood, bamboo and cork have actually become popular alternatives due to their rapid regrowth and sustainability. Bamboo grows dramatically faster than traditional hardwood trees, making it a sustainable choice that resembles the warmth and charm of classic wood floorings.
